How the fictional Cordyceps parasite operates
The fictional Cordyceps parasite in “The Last of Us” operates by infecting a human host, initially through bites from the Infected or inhalation of airborne spores. Once inside the body, the fungus rapidly spreads, invading the brain and nervous system. It does not kill the host immediately but gradually takes over their motor functions and cognitive processes, driving them to spread the infection further. The host’s body is then manipulated into a grotesque puppet, compelled by the fungus’s biological imperative to propagate.
The Inspiration Behind the Game’s Infection Lore
The chilling infection lore of “The Last of Us” draws significant inspiration from the real-world Cordyceps fungi, particularly species known to infect insects. Nature documentaries have showcased parasitic fungi that hijack the minds of ants and other arthropods, compelling them to climb to high vantage points before dying, allowing the fungal spores to disperse widely. This fascinating and terrifying natural phenomenon provided a compelling, albeit exaggerated, biological basis for the game’s concept of a mind-controlling fungal pathogen, sparking the imagination behind the global pandemic.

Real-World Cordyceps vs. The Last of Us Fictional Lore

Distinguishing Between Fungal Fact and Fiction
It is crucial to distinguish between the fascinating biological basis of real-life Cordyceps fungi and the highly dramatized portrayal in “The Last of Us.” Real Cordyceps species are a diverse group of fungi, predominantly found in tropical regions, that parasitize insects and other arthropods. While they do alter host behavior, they do not create sentient, human-like “zombies” or spread to humans in a similar manner. The game takes significant artistic liberties to craft its terrifying narrative, drawing inspiration from natural phenomena rather than providing a literal depiction. Is the “Zombie Fungus” from The Last of Us Real?
The “zombie fungus” depicted in “The Last of Us” is a fictionalized concept. While real-world Cordyceps fungi are indeed parasitic and can manipulate insect behavior, there is no scientific evidence or indication that they could infect humans or turn them into aggressive, zombie-like creatures. The potential for Cordyceps to infect humans is negligible, as their biological mechanisms are highly specialized for specific insect hosts. The actual effects of Cordyceps mushroom on humans typically involve traditional uses in some cultures, rather than parasitic infection.
Artistic Liberties and Scientific Inaccuracies in the portrayal
The creators of “The Last of Us” openly acknowledge the artistic liberties taken with the scientific facts. For instance, the game’s depiction of airborne spore transmission is a key plot device, whereas real Cordyceps spores primarily affect insects and require specific environmental conditions. The rapid progression of the *cordyceps mushroom last of us* infection in humans and the dramatic physical transformations are also significant scientific inaccuracies, designed to enhance the horror and gameplay experience rather than reflect biological reality. These creative choices are fundamental to the game’s narrative success.

How Cordyceps Spreads in The Last of Us
In the world of “The Last of Us,” the Cordyceps infection primarily spreads through two main vectors: direct exposure to airborne spores and bites from already infected individuals. Spores are common in enclosed, undisturbed areas where the fungus has had time to grow on deceased hosts, posing a significant environmental hazard. Bites are the most immediate and common method of transmission during direct encounters with the Infected, rapidly introducing the fungal pathogen into the bloodstream.

Overview of Cordyceps Infection Stages
The Cordyceps infection in “The Last of Us” progresses through distinct stages, each marked by increasing fungal growth and host degradation. These stages are broadly categorized as Runners, Stalkers, Clickers, Bloaters, and Shamblers. Each stage represents a more advanced state of the parasitic takeover, leading to significant physiological and behavioral changes in the host. The duration of each stage is influenced by factors such as the host’s health, the point of infection, and the strain of the fungus.
Symptoms and Behavioral Changes at Each Stage
In the early “Runner” stage, symptoms include extreme aggression, loss of higher cognitive functions, and rapid, erratic movements. As the infection progresses to “Stalkers,” the fungus begins to grow externally, particularly around the head, leading to stealthier, more cunning behavior. “Clickers” are characterized by complete blindness due to extensive fungal growth covering their faces, forcing them to rely on echolocation to navigate and hunt. In the advanced “Bloater” and “Shambler” stages, the fungal growth becomes extremely dense and armor-like, leading to immense strength and the ability to project corrosive spores, rendering the host almost unrecognizable and exceptionally dangerous.

Advanced Infected Stages: Bloaters and Shamblers
Beyond the Clickers lie the truly monstrous advanced infected stages: Bloaters and Shamblers. Bloaters are hosts whose bodies have been almost entirely encased in a thick, fungal armor, making them incredibly resilient to damage. They are slow but immensely strong and can tear survivors apart or hurl corrosive spore sacks. Shamblers, a variant found in the second game, are similarly armored but are known to release clouds of acidic spores upon getting close to their victims, inflicting damage and obscuring vision.

Origin and Impact of the Cordyceps Outbreak
Hypothesized Initial Spread and Global Pandemic
The hypothesized initial spread of the Cordyceps outbreak in “The Last of Us” points to a rapid global pandemic that began in the autumn of 2013. Lore suggests the fungus mutated to tolerate human body temperature, perhaps originating from contaminated crops. The swift and silent nature of spore transmission, combined with the aggressive behavior of the newly Infected, meant that governments and militaries were quickly overwhelmed. Major cities became hotbeds of infection, collapsing societal structures within weeks, leading to widespread panic and chaos.
In-Lore Attempts at Control or Countering the Outbreak
According to “The Last of Us” lore, various desperate attempts were made to control or counter the Cordyceps outbreak, all ultimately failing. These included mass quarantines, military occupation of cities, and the creation of “Quarantine Zones.” However, the sheer scale of the infection, coupled with the rapid mutation and adaptability of the fungus, rendered these efforts futile. The result was a complete societal collapse and humanity’s struggle for survival, leading to a fragmented world where small pockets of survivors live under constant threat from both the Infected and other desperate humans.
